type github.com/aws/aws-sdk-go-v2/service/internal/s3shared/arn.InvalidARNError
30 uses
github.com/aws/aws-sdk-go-v2/service/internal/s3shared/arn (current package)
accesspoint_arn.go#L28: return AccessPointARN{}, InvalidARNError{ARN: a, Reason: "FIPS region not allowed in ARN"}
accesspoint_arn.go#L31: return AccessPointARN{}, InvalidARNError{ARN: a, Reason: "account-id not set"}
accesspoint_arn.go#L34: return AccessPointARN{}, InvalidARNError{ARN: a, Reason: "resource-id not set"}
accesspoint_arn.go#L37: return AccessPointARN{}, InvalidARNError{ARN: a, Reason: "sub resource not supported"}
accesspoint_arn.go#L42: return AccessPointARN{}, InvalidARNError{ARN: a, Reason: "resource-id not set"}
arn.go#L39: return nil, InvalidARNError{ARN: a, Reason: "partition not set"}
arn.go#L43: return nil, InvalidARNError{ARN: a, Reason: "service is not supported"}
arn.go#L47: return nil, InvalidARNError{ARN: a, Reason: "resource not set"}
arn.go#L77: type InvalidARNError struct {
arn.go#L83: func (e InvalidARNError) Error() string {
outpost_arn.go#L30: return nil, InvalidARNError{ARN: a, Reason: "region not set"}
outpost_arn.go#L34: return nil, InvalidARNError{ARN: a, Reason: "FIPS region not allowed in ARN"}
outpost_arn.go#L38: return nil, InvalidARNError{ARN: a, Reason: "account-id not set"}
outpost_arn.go#L43: return nil, InvalidARNError{ARN: a, Reason: "outpost resource-id not set"}
outpost_arn.go#L48: return nil, InvalidARNError{
outpost_arn.go#L79: return nil, InvalidARNError{ARN: a, Reason: "unknown resource set for outpost ARN"}
outpost_arn.go#L117: return bucketName, InvalidARNError{ARN: a, Reason: "bucket resource-id not set"}
outpost_arn.go#L120: return bucketName, InvalidARNError{ARN: a, Reason: "sub resource not supported"}
outpost_arn.go#L125: return bucketName, InvalidARNError{ARN: a, Reason: "bucket resource-id not set"}
github.com/aws/aws-sdk-go-v2/service/s3/internal/arn
arn_parser.go#L33: return arn.AccessPointARN{}, arn.InvalidARNError{ARN: a, Reason: fmt.Sprintf("service is not %s or %s", s3Namespace, s3ObjectsLambdaNamespace)}
arn_parser.go#L37: return arn.OutpostAccessPointARN{}, arn.InvalidARNError{ARN: a, Reason: "service is not %s"}
arn_parser.go#L41: return nil, arn.InvalidARNError{ARN: a, Reason: "unknown resource type"}
arn_parser.go#L48: return arn.OutpostAccessPointARN{}, arn.InvalidARNError{ARN: a, Reason: "service is not s3-outposts"}
arn_parser.go#L52: return arn.OutpostAccessPointARN{}, arn.InvalidARNError{ARN: a, Reason: "outpost resource-id not set"}
arn_parser.go#L56: return arn.OutpostAccessPointARN{}, arn.InvalidARNError{
arn_parser.go#L63: return arn.OutpostAccessPointARN{}, arn.InvalidARNError{ARN: a, Reason: "outpost resource-id not set"}
arn_parser.go#L71: return arn.OutpostAccessPointARN{}, arn.InvalidARNError{ARN: a, Reason: "region is not set"}
arn_parser.go#L81: return arn.OutpostAccessPointARN{}, arn.InvalidARNError{ARN: a, Reason: "access-point resource not set in Outpost ARN"}
arn_parser.go#L91: return arn.S3ObjectLambdaAccessPointARN{}, arn.InvalidARNError{ARN: a, Reason: fmt.Sprintf("service is not %s", s3ObjectsLambdaNamespace)}
arn_parser.go#L95: return arn.S3ObjectLambdaAccessPointARN{}, arn.InvalidARNError{ARN: a, Reason: fmt.Sprintf("%s region not set", s3ObjectsLambdaNamespace)}